源码扫描仪:守护软件安全的得力助手 文章
在信息化时代,软件已成为现代社会运行的重要基础设施。随着软件的广泛应用,软件安全问题日益凸显。为了确保软件的安全性,源码扫描仪应运而生。本文将深入探讨源码扫描仪的概念、作用以及其在软件安全领域的重要性。
一、源码扫描仪概述
源码扫描仪,顾名思义,是一种用于对软件源代码进行安全检测的工具。它通过分析源代码中的潜在安全漏洞,为开发者和安全人员提供风险预警,从而提高软件的安全性。源码扫描仪通常具备以下特点:
1.自动化检测:源码扫描仪可以自动分析源代码,无需人工干预,提高检测效率。
2.全面性:源码扫描仪覆盖多种编程语言,如Java、C/C++、Python等,能够检测多种类型的漏洞。
3.高效性:源码扫描仪能够在短时间内对大量代码进行扫描,提高工作效率。
4.可定制性:源码扫描仪可根据用户需求,定制检测规则,提高检测准确性。
二、源码扫描仪的作用
1.提高软件安全性:源码扫描仪能够检测出软件中的潜在安全漏洞,帮助开发者在软件发布前修复这些问题,降低软件被攻击的风险。
2.保障用户隐私:源码扫描仪能够检测出可能导致用户隐私泄露的漏洞,如SQL注入、XSS攻击等,保障用户信息安全。
3.优化开发流程:源码扫描仪可以集成到软件开发流程中,实现安全检测的自动化,提高开发效率。
4.降低维护成本:通过使用源码扫描仪,开发者在软件发布前就能发现并修复安全问题,减少后期维护成本。
三、源码扫描仪在软件安全领域的重要性
1.预防安全事件:源码扫描仪能够及时发现软件中的安全漏洞,预防安全事件的发生,降低企业损失。
2.提升企业竞争力:随着信息安全意识的提高,越来越多的企业开始关注软件安全。使用源码扫描仪,企业能够提升自身在信息安全领域的竞争力。
3.符合法规要求:我国相关法律法规对软件安全提出了明确要求。使用源码扫描仪,企业能够更好地满足法规要求,降低法律风险。
4.推动行业健康发展:源码扫描仪在软件安全领域的应用,有助于推动整个行业向更加安全的方向发展。
总之,源码扫描仪作为一种有效的安全检测工具,在软件安全领域发挥着重要作用。随着技术的不断发展,源码扫描仪将在未来发挥更大的作用,为我国软件安全事业贡献力量。
四、结语
源码扫描仪作为保障软件安全的重要工具,已经成为开发者和安全人员不可或缺的助手。在信息化时代,我们应充分认识源码扫描仪的重要性,将其应用于软件开发和运维的各个环节,共同维护软件安全,为我国信息化建设保驾护航。同时,企业和个人也应不断提高安全意识,共同营造一个安全、健康的软件环境。